Solution to issue cannot be found in the documentation.
[X] I checked the documentation.
Issue
We found an undefined symbol problem in py310 and py311
Client 127.0.0.1:37096] request declined in mgs_hook_fixups
mod_wsgi (pid=13166, process='DEMO', application=''): Loading Python script file '/home/user/DEMO/wsgi/wms.wsgi'.
mod_wsgi (pid=13166): Failed to exec Python script file '/DEMO/wsgi/wms.wsgi'.
mod_wsgi (pid=13166): Exception occurred processing WSGI script 'wms.wsgi'.
Traceback (most recent call last):
File "/DEMO/wsgi/wms.wsgi", line 29, in <module>
from mslib.mswms.wms import app as application
File "mssenv/lib/python3.10/site-packages/mslib/mswms/wms.py", line 67, in <module>
from mslib.mswms.gallery_builder import add_image, write_html, add_levels, add_times, \\
File "mssenv/lib/python3.10/site-packages/mslib/mswms/gallery_builder.py", line 35, in <module>
from mslib.mswms.mpl_vsec import AbstractVerticalSectionStyle
File "mssenv/lib/python3.10/site-packages/mslib/mswms/mpl_vsec.py", line 42, in <module>
from mslib.utils.units import convert_to, units
File "mssenv/lib/python3.10/site-packages/mslib/utils/units.py", line 31, in <module>
from metpy.units import units, check_units # noqa
File "mssenv/lib/python3.10/site-packages/metpy/__init__.py", line 15, in <module>
from .xarray import * # noqa: F401, F403, E402
File "mssenv/lib/python3.10/site-packages/metpy/xarray.py", line 26, in <module>
from pyproj import CRS, Proj
File "mssenv/lib/python3.10/site-packages/pyproj/__init__.py", line 33, in <module>
import pyproj.network
File "mssenv/lib/python3.10/site-packages/pyproj/network.py", line 10, in <module>
from pyproj._network import ( # noqa: F401 pylint: disable=unused-import
ImportError: mssenv/lib/python3.10/site-packages/pyproj/../../.././libcurl.so.4: undefined symbol: nghttp2_option_set_no_rfc9113_leading_and_trailing_ws_validation
AH02001: Connection closed to child 512 with standard shutdown (server
```)
mod_wsgi (pid=5246): Failed to exec Python script file '/home/user/DEMO/wsgi/wms.wsgi'.
[Thu May 23mod_wsgi (pid=5246): Exception occurred processing WSGI script '/home/user/DEMO/wsgi/wms.wsgi'.
Traceback (most recent call last):
File "/home/user/DEMO/wsgi/wms.wsgi", line 16, in <module>
from mslib.mswms.wms import app as application
File "/home/user/Miniforge/envs/mssenv/lib/python3.11/site-packages/mslib/mswms/wms.py", line 67, in <module>
from mslib.mswms.gallery_builder import add_image, write_html, add_levels, add_times, \\
File "/home/user/Miniforge/envs/mssenv/lib/python3.11/site-packages/mslib/mswms/gallery_builder.py", line 35, in <module>
from mslib.mswms.mpl_vsec import AbstractVerticalSectionStyle
File "/home/user/Miniforge/envs/mssenv/lib/python3.11/site-packages/mslib/mswms/mpl_vsec.py", line 42, in <module>
from mslib.utils.units import convert_to, units
File "/home/user/Miniforge/envs/mssenv/lib/python3.11/site-packages/mslib/utils/units.py", line 31, in <module>
from metpy.units import units, check_units # noqa
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/home/user/Miniforge/envs/mssenv/lib/python3.11/site-packages/metpy/__init__.py", line 15, in <module>
from .xarray import * # noqa: F401, F403, E402
^^^^^^^^^^^^^^^^^^^^^
File "/home/user/Miniforge/envs/mssenv/lib/python3.11/site-packages/metpy/xarray.py", line 26, in <module>
from pyproj import CRS, Proj
File "/home/user/Miniforge/envs/mssenv/lib/python3.11/site-packages/pyproj/__init__.py", line 33, in <module>
import pyproj.network
File "/home/user/Miniforge/envs/mssenv/lib/python3.11/site-packages/pyproj/network.py", line 10, in <module>
from pyproj._network import ( # noqa: F401 pylint: disable=unused-import
[Thu May 23 ImportError: /home/user/Miniforge/envs/mssenv/lib/python3.11/site-packages/pyproj/../../.././libcurl.so.4: undefined symbol: nghttp2_option_set_no_rfc9113_leading_and_trailing_ws_validation
Solution to issue cannot be found in the documentation.
Issue
We found an undefined symbol problem in py310 and py311
linking to https://github.com/Open-MSS/MSS/issues/2387
The last version without this was 7.87.0
Installed packages
Environment info